
The Tissue Biorepository and Procurement Service (TBAPS) is a repository of human specimens accessible to the UAMS research community. We have an IRB approved protocol and general consent form that allows us to consent patients, acquire samples from the pathology grossing room, and provide these samples to researchers who have appropriate approval. Solid tissues and fluid specimens (serum or urine) are stored in liquid nitrogen tanks. Solid tissues may also be embedded into paraffin. Our specimen collection has over 12,000 tissue samples along with de-identified sample related pathology data available from a variety of organs and an extensive list of diagnoses. Researchers may browse the collection of specimens using an online database management software (CaTissue) to search donor demographics, diagnosis, and/or other sample-related data to identify and request specimens of interest.
